Imagine you're building a new software program. How do you ensure it truly addresses the needs of the people who will use it? User stories act as a bridge between the user's perspective and the technical world of software development. What is a User Story? A user story is a concise na...
User stories are written in everyday language and describe a specific goal (what) from the perspective of an individual (who) along with the reason (why) he/she wants it. In software development, the goal is often a new product feature, the individual is some type of end-user and the ...
AnAgile user storyis meant to be short, usually fitting on a sticky note or note card. The business should write user stories in the language of the customer so that it is clear to both the business and the development team what the customer wants and why they want it. In some cases,...
What is an Abuser Story in Software Development? In software development and product management, an abuser story is a user story from the point of view of amalicious adversary. Abuser stories are used with agile software development methodologies as the basis for defining the activities that should...
Now that we know the ins and outs of user stories in an Agile workflow, let’s walk through the process of writing your own. For this step-by-step guide, we’ll use Agile software development as an example. 1. Identify the end-user The first step is to identify the end-user. If ...
TCO is much higher and depends on the size of the user base. Community participation The community participating in development, review, critique, and enhancement of the software is the essence of open source. Closed community. Interoperability with other open source software This will depend on...
Quicker UI development Customizable UI Addon Ecosystem Seamless Integration This guide explores what Storybook testing is and how it can be leveraged in software development. What is Storybook? Storybook is a JavaScript-based development tool, that allows developers to create the user interface component...
Benchmark your software security program Home Glossary Definition The Software Development Life Cycle (SDLC) is a structured process that enables the production of high-quality, low-cost software, in the shortest possible production time. The goal of the SDLC is to produce superior software that me...
software is a set of instructions that tells a computer, web-based application, or other devices what to do. it helps the device understand what to do and how to do it. through software, you can interact with the device in ways they couldn't before. for example, with software, you ...
Scope.An organization should define its goals for a behavior analysis system and the specific types of behavior the system is expected to monitor. This includes having the means of collecting the necessary data in place. User access.Team members who need permission to use the system and receive...